Selank is a 7-amino-acid synthetic research peptide derived from the naturally-occurring immunomodulatory peptide tuftsin. Literature describes its intranasal-delivery pharmacokinetics and central activity.
Published research examines Selank's modulation of GABAergic and serotonergic signalling pathways alongside BDNF upregulation in cellular and animal research models.
